9.3 Electrical Wiring
The cables have connectors for an electrical connection system.
The module cables should be fixed onto the module frame or support in order to avoid
any stress to the connector.
The cables should avoid exposure to direct sunlight.
The junction box CANNOT be opened or destroyed, and the place of installation should
avoid rain.
Recommended number of installed modules:
Calculated under condition of +10% tolerance of Voc at STC. The sum of Voc of
series modules must NOT exceed the maximum system voltage under any
condition.
The number of series and parallel MUST CONSIDER the capabilities of inverter.
